An investigation into the use of sol-gel processing for the fabrication of
tellurite thin films from tellurium ethoxide precursor is described. The hy
drolysis and condensation of tellurium ethoxide are discussed, together wit
h the results of the decomposition process of its hydrolysis product under
air and argon atmospheres. The structural and morphological properties of t
he resulting tellurite films are characterised. The success in sol-gel proc
essing for tellurite materials provides new opportunities for making tellur
ite thin film devices with practical applications. (C) 2001 Elsevier Scienc
